Title :
Discrete frequency-coding waveform design for netted radar systems

Abstract :
A novel method is proposed to design discrete frequency-coding waveforms (DFCWs) for the netted radar systems. Some of the designed results are presented and they indicate that the proposed algorithm is effective for the DFCW design.
